Hello, So your only going to use 22 L/R rifles as a starter, What will the Training Days consist of ??

The training days will provide those new to the concept to learn the skills to make the matches more enjoyable and productive.

They will also allow those who have no intention of shooting the matches to get the required practice in before they look to take their skills to the side of a hill to engage live quarry!

Typically 4 rounds a stage and 12 stages max, so 50 rounds plus what you need for getting PF and zero sorted.

Been asked a few questions on this.

If you shoot all the targets first time then you’ll use 4 rounds per stage. If, however, you miss them all 1st time and you need a 2nd shot on each target then you’ll use twice as many rounds per stage.

Which will double your round count.

I know this sounds obvious but people asked for clarity, so here you have it.

If in doubt please refer to the rules where more information on stages and round count can be found.

Please also note that each match may have a different number of stages (depending on the venue and circumstances) but this will be clarified prior to each event.
